Structural Underpinning in Tampa, FL
Structural underpinning services involve strengthening and stabilizing the foundation of a property to prevent or repair issues caused by shifting or settling. This service is commonly requested for projects such as addressing uneven floors, cracked walls, or foundation movement in homes and commercial buildings. Property owners typically seek underpinning when signs of foundation instability appear, or when planning renovations that require a solid, reliable base. Understanding the scope of work, the methods used, and the impact on property access are important considerations before requesting underpinning services.
These services often include installing new supports, piers, or braces beneath a building to restore stability. Homeowners should inquire about the types of underpinning available, the process involved, and how it may affect the property during and after the work. It is also useful to understand the potential causes of foundation issues, such as soil conditions or moisture levels, to better assess the need for stabilization. Proper underpinning can help preserve the integrity of a property and maintain its value over time.

Common Structural Underpinning Jobs
Foundation stabilization - techniques to prevent settling or shifting of the building's foundation.
Pier and beam underpinning - reinforcing or replacing support piers to improve stability.
Slab underpinning - strengthening concrete slabs that have become uneven or cracked.
Soil stabilization - improving soil conditions to reduce movement beneath the structure.
Beam underpinning - supporting sagging or bowed beams to restore proper alignment.
Settlement repair - addressing uneven sinking caused by soil or moisture changes.
Structural Underpinning Questions
What is structural underpinning? Structural underpinning involves strengthening or stabilizing a building’s foundation to address issues like settling or uneven floors.
Why might a property need underpinning services? Underpinning is typically needed when a foundation shows signs of movement, cracks, or sinking that could affect the building’s stability.
What types of projects require underpinning? Common projects include home extensions, foundation repairs, or addressing damage caused by soil movement or moisture issues.
How does underpinning improve property stability? It reinforces the foundation, preventing further movement and helping maintain the structural integrity of the building.
